Transaction 8b668dad86c0215da32b6cf9ef89289e6bb2203248b6b2661e0187809f16287b
1 Input
1 Output
-
8b668dad86c0215da32b6cf9ef89289e6bb2203248b6b2661e0187809f16287b:0
- value
- 44067
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8428c70182546152f56d232dd4c825cc4547f416 OP_EQUAL
- address
- 3Djoy8Hk4ZEwnt2KJ6qXywKNZY2gVB9dkf